Output aa51607da09106b2462535d3aaa8b690c9e2545b162dce92a44bf25fc5827089:4

value
554197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ac21a957492d5da2e732f463a45cbdffec5bd548 OP_EQUAL
address
3HPAUNyr1CrEfJmAyQmXJ5aF2b4wr1kqt8
transaction
aa51607da09106b2462535d3aaa8b690c9e2545b162dce92a44bf25fc5827089
confirmations
187484
spent
true